A lot of buyers actually believe that the whole process of purchasing a home is rather overpowering. It is reasonable, as there is a huge amount of paperwork that must be taken care of, numerous legal issues that have to be attended to, as well as the amount of money involved in the transaction. Not everybody actually knows what they are signing off to for six or even seven digits. It is kind of daunting but it is just normal, and what you really must be knowledgeable about is how to make negotiations.
You should ask yourself: Would your purchase be tantamount to the period of time you are going to stay in the house? Usually, there is a rule of thumb of five up to seven years. You should keep in mind that this is an extremely delicate financial, as well as legal commitment, and that you will be putting down a lot of interest up front. The more reasonable choice is to purchase a home if you are going to stay for more than several years. Remember, with ownership comes a great duty of maintaining and taking care of the home.
Here is another pointer you have to follow: Have your mortgage loan pre-approved so as to make the process a lot easier. You should properly manage your finances, and with the aid of an expert real estate agent, put together an agreement with the lending company. You should show what you possess and say what you like. That way, when the company grants to present you this amount you are asking for, you can obtain a rational figure to work with.
You may be aware of what you like in your dream home, but are you aware of what you really need? The majority of buyers dream about all of these things, such as the neighborhood, security, style, access to various places (work, school, hospital, and so on). However, they have a tendency to ignore the things that really matter, especially in the long run. You need to set your priorities straight, as there are lots of things that have to be taken into consideration in this arduous process.
